Meiotic behavior, pollen morphology, interphasic nucleus pattern and karyotype description for Senna occidentalis (Caesalpinioideae — Fabaceae) are presented. The species had non-reticulate interphasic nucleus and homogeneous chromosome condensing with minute distal late-condensing portions in prometaphase. In mitotic metaphase, chromosome number was 2n = 28 (9 m + 5 sm), with secondary constriction in one chromosome pair. Detection of four nucleoli indicated existence of two chromosome pairs bearing Nucleolar Organizer Region (NOR). Meiotic behavior was regular, with high meiotic index (95%). Pollen grains, classified as polar/spheroidal, presented 90% viability.
